Disney's Polynesian Village Resort does have adjoining rooms available, though they cannot be guaranteed, only requested. With their inventory of available adjoining rooms, Disney prioritizes larger families that are visiting with younger children where the connecting room is essential.
If keeping everyone together is a requirement for you, there are some options. At the Polynesian there are now the Bora Bora Bungalows. These over-the-water retreats sleep 8 with two dedicated bedrooms, but they can be more expensive than some other accommodations.
Your next option is to look at some of the Deluxe villas at other resorts. There are a variety of 2- and 3-bedroom choices across Walt Disney World, at such locations as the nearby
Disney's Contemporary Resort and
Disney's Grand Floridian Resort & Spa.
Finally, there are the family suites, like the ones at
Disney's Art of Animation Resort. These richly decorated suites at the Value resort sleep up to 6, while still allowing the luxury of a dedicated master bedroom.
